WebAutomatic parallelization with @jit . Setting the parallel option for jit() enables a Numba transformation pass that attempts to automatically parallelize and perform other optimizations on (part of) a function. At the moment, this feature only works on CPUs. Parallel Range. Numba implements the ability to run loops in parallel, similar to OpenMP parallel for loops and Cython’s prange.
